Quarterly Planning Note — Divestiture of the Coastal Tooling Unit

For the finance team: the sale of the Coastal Tooling unit to Pellmark Industries remains on track for close in Q3. Please finalize the carve-out balance sheet, reconcile intercompany positions, and prepare the working-capital adjustment schedule by month-end. Audit support requests should be prioritized. For planning purposes, note the following sensitive item:

internal memo for hawef-kahif: The finance team signed off on a budget of $25.9 million for Project Sorox. The renewal with Pelokek Logistics closes at $51.7 million a year, 52 percent below the last contract.

Handover from Marek to whoever is on call tonight. The Pipwhistle notification fan-out started queuing hard around midday after the digest batch doubled. I raised the consumer concurrency on the relay workers from 8 to 12 and paused the low-priority marketing topic, which brought lag under two minutes. If the backlog climbs past 500k again, shed the digest topic first, not the transactional one. Don't restart the broker; that makes it worse. Full mitigation steps and the drain procedure are on the internal page here.

runbook for tajep-yahig: https://artifactory.lumictech.corp/repo

- [ ] Verify the Quellora search relevance tuning notes are attached to the release PR before approving. The synonym expansion weights changed in this cycle, and the BM25 boost for title fields was lowered from 2.4 to 1.9 per the Marlowe team's offline evals. Confirm the notes match the shipped config exactly. The token for the eval build appears below.

build token for kagaf-hahof: htk14_9d3d4d26d7d8de

TICKET-902: Bloom filter drift on Keyvault-Lite nodes. Node kv-7 runs a 12-bit-per-key filter while the fleet standard is 10, inflating memory and skewing false-positive metrics in the Dunmore dashboard. Someone hand-tuned it during the March latency push. Realign to baseline at next restart. Observed config on kv-7 is below.

service settings:
[eliix]
port = 7000
region = central-4
host = eliix.crelvocorp.local
team = fraael
timeout_ms = 3000
retries = 4